Albany won for the third time in four games Tuesday, beating Brown, 74-68, on the road. Four of the Great Danes' five wins this season have come away from home. Albany (5-4) got to the free throw line 46 times and made 35 of its tries to cement the win. Junior Sam Rowley led the way with 20 points.
Also Tuesday, Hartford (3-8) allowed Central Conn. State to shoot 53 percent from the field and failed to build off its win over Holy Cross Saturday, falling 73-59. Yolonzo Moore II led the Hawks with 19 points.
UMBC (3-6) is the lone America East squad in action on Wednesday as it goes across town to take on Coppin State at 7:30 p.m. Rodney Elliott, the league's top freshman scorer (13.8 ppg), leads the Retrievers while Chase Plummer is averaing 13.9 points per game, including 24.0 ppg over his last two games.
